Kisan Padyatra: Rahul Gandhi Hands Over a Cheque to Deceased Farmer's Family in Telangana

Congress party vice-president and son of former PM late Rajeev Gandhi, Rahul Gandhi, is on a ‘kisan padyatra’. He reached out to the family of Rajeshwar, a farmer who committed suicide sometime ego, and gave them a cheque of Rs. two lacks.

Gandhi began his 15-kilometre long padyatra from Nirmal in the Adilabad district of newly formed Telangana state.

Few days back, the heir to the Congress Presidential throne raised the issues of farmer in the parliament, and went on to meet the farmers of Punjab and Maharashtra.


The reports say that around 9000 farmers have committed suicide in the state due to the prevailing agrarian crisis all across the country.
